    I had a set on my old ti they looked pretty good. I think you have to make sure you get the ones for the 4 door though. I think the 2 door ones dont fit. Since the ti is just a mix basket of 4door and 2door parts. (btw just checked and I was right you need the corners for the sedan)

    Well they didnt have 4 door Tis, the ti just has the same door that the 4 door uses. As far as the price on that stuff i think 600 sounds good for a BMW bumper. If your going to replace the front bumper you should really get an M3 front bumper. Well in the pics it looks like thats what you already had but stick with that.

    If you go on bimmerforums.com search for some of the vendors I bet there are a good 3 or 4 vendors that sell front bumpers and the like.
